Apple Shifts AirPods Production ⁢to India: ⁣A Deep Dive into Foxconn‘s⁣ Expansion

Apple’s‌ strategic move to diversify its manufacturing base continues, with a significant ‍expansion of AirPods production in India. This⁣ isn’t just about cost savings; it’s ‍a complex interplay of geopolitical factors, supply chain resilience, and tapping⁣ into a burgeoning market. Recent reports indicate that Foxconn, a​ key Apple supply chain partner, ‌is dramatically increasing its personal audio manufacturing capacity in the country, specifically at its Hyderabad facility. But what does this mean for‌ consumers, Apple’s supply chain, and the future of tech manufacturing? Let’s explore the details.

The Growing Importance of India in Apple’s Strategy

For years, China has ​been the dominant force in Apple’s manufacturing. However, recent ⁢global events – including trade tensions and pandemic-related disruptions⁢ – have highlighted the risks of ⁤over-reliance on a single country. India presents a compelling alternative. It boasts a large, skilled workforce, a growing domestic market, and government incentives aimed at attracting foreign investment in manufacturing.

Did You Know? Apple began assembling iPhones⁣ in India in 2017, ‌and the country is now a ⁤crucial hub for iPhone production, accounting for a ⁢significant percentage of global output.

Apple’s initial foray into⁢ Indian manufacturing focused primarily on the iPhone. However, ‍the expansion to⁢ include AirPods signifies a​ broadening commitment. This diversification isn’t just about mitigating risk; it’s about building ⁤a more agile and responsive supply chain.

Foxconn’s Expansion in Hyderabad: What’s Happening?

foxconn Interconnect ⁣Technology (FIT), a subsidiary of Foxconn, commenced mass production of AirPods in its Hyderabad⁢ plant⁢ in April 2024. ‌Now, according⁢ to sources cited by the Economic​ Times, the company is ⁤poised⁢ to double production capacity at the Kongara Kalan facility within the coming months.

This expansion involves significant investment in infrastructure and personnel. While ⁢specific details remain confidential, it’s clear that Foxconn is betting big on India’s potential as ‌a manufacturing powerhouse. This move aligns with the Indian government’s “Make in India” initiative,⁤ which offers financial incentives and streamlined regulations to encourage domestic ⁤manufacturing.

Implications for consumers and the Market

What does this shift mean for you, the consumer? Several potential benefits coudl emerge:

* Reduced Supply Chain Disruptions: A more diversified‌ supply chain makes Apple less vulnerable to disruptions caused by geopolitical events⁤ or⁣ natural disasters.
* Possibly Lower Prices: While not guaranteed, increased competition and lower manufacturing costs in India could eventually translate to more competitive ‍pricing for AirPods.
* faster Delivery Times: Local production can reduce lead times and improve availability in the Indian⁢ market and potentially other regions.
* Increased Accessibility: A stronger presence in India allows apple to better cater to the growing demand for ‌its products in this key market.

However, it’s ​important to note that these benefits may not be immediate. Supply chain ⁢adjustments take time, and various factors ‍can influence ​pricing and availability.

Beyond AirPods: The Future of Apple Manufacturing in India

The expansion of AirPods production is ⁢likely just the beginning. Apple is actively exploring opportunities​ to manufacture other products in India, including‌ iPads, ‍Apple Watches, and potentially even ​Macs. This broader diversification strategy is driven by several factors:

* Geopolitical ​Considerations: Reducing reliance on China ‍is a key priority for Apple, given the ongoing ‌trade tensions and geopolitical uncertainties.
* Supply Chain⁣ Resilience: A more geographically diverse supply chain enhances Apple’s ability to withstand disruptions.
* Market Growth: India ⁣is‌ one of the‌ fastest-growing smartphone markets in the world, and Apple is keen to capitalize on this possibility.
* ⁣ Cost Optimization: While not the primary driver, lower labor​ costs in India can contribute to cost ⁣savings.
